About the Business

American Eagle Outfitters, founded in 1977 by brothers Jerry and Mark Silverman, is a leading U.S. retailer known for trendy casual clothing and accessories for young adults. Headquartered in Pittsburgh, the company operates over 1,000 stores globally and is recognized for its quality denim and commitment to inclusivity and sustainability.

I only wear AE jeans. I ordered jeans that are a style I've never tried and they didn't fit as well as the Super Stretch so the jeans were returned. I used the AE return policy of paying $5.00 for SH and I took it to the post office they assigned. I followed directions exactly as told, however the post office employee said I owed additional $11.75. I told them AE charged me $5.00 for a pre-paid return label, however the USPS said I still owed $11.75 so I called AE. They were very kind, but only agreed to refund $7.00. It's something, but I still paid $9.75 for a $5.00 return. It's not a lot of money really, just why charge for a return label if it's not going to work? I'll just stick to returning their items at the Mall. Probably spend the same cost on fuel, but at least I can walk about the Mall and enjoy! Still love AE jeans!
